The rest of this page is written for your agent
Tell your agent to set up PublishQ from publishq.com/openclaw. It fetches this URL, reads the block below, and wires itself into OpenClaw.
PublishQ connects your accounts on Instagram, TikTok, YouTube, X, LinkedIn, Facebook, Threads and Bluesky, and exposes every endpoint as a CLI command, an MCP tool and a REST call. The user is the human in the loop: they hold the key, they approve what goes out, and they own anything destructive. These steps wire OpenClaw up specifically.
- 1
Install the skill.
npx skills add PublishQ/social-media-skills --skill publishq -a openclawgives you the full instructions as a skill you keep: every platform's own settings and limits, how media is uploaded and prepared, how one post carries different copy per account, and the same calls through MCP, the SDK or plain HTTP. Read it instead of searching for any of this.Done when the skill is installed, or you have read it and are following it here.
- 2
Get the key. Every call authenticates with a PUBLISHQ_API_KEY from https://publishq.com/app/settings, and it belongs to the human in the loop. Ask the user to paste one to you, or create it there yourself if you can already act in their browser. Never continue as though you had a key, and never invent one.
- 3
Wire yourself into OpenClaw. Install the CLI:
npm install -g @publishq/cli, thenpq auth set --key "pq_live_...", which saves to ~/.publishq/config.json. Every command returns JSON, and it adds nothing to the tools you have to hold in context. That is OpenClaw wired up. If you would rather use MCP tools instead: Runnpm install -g @publishq/cli, thenpq auth set --key 'pq_live_your_key_here'. If you would rather have the tools in OpenClaw's own menu,openclaw mcp add publishq --command npx --arg -y --arg @publishq/mcp --env PUBLISHQ_API_KEY=pq_live_your_key_hereregisters the MCP server instead. - 4
Verify, and keep the ids it gives you. Run
pq accounts list, or if you registered the MCP server, check it withpq accounts list --pretty, which prints the accounts you connected. For the MCP route,openclaw mcp doctor publishq --probe. Use eachidit returns verbatim, sinceaccountIdis a UUID and an invented value such asacc_linkedinis rejected with a 400.Done when that call returns the user's connected accounts.
If it fails, stop and tell the user what the error said. Do not carry on as though the tools were there. - 5
Upload any media first, and keep the ids. Skip this for a text-only post.
pq media upload --file ./photo.jpg(orpublishq_upload_media) returns an id, and that id is what the post carries: a file cannot be handed to the create call. One id attaches to every account in the post, so a picture that goes everywhere is one upload. Send the file you have and do not prepare it first: PublishQ converts the format each platform accepts, scales down what is too large and compresses what is too heavy, per platform, keeping transparency. Cropping is the one thing left to the user, because the aspect ratio is an editorial choice.Done when every file the post needs has a media id.
- 6
Check what your platform wants. Most platforms need nothing beyond the post itself. Some take their own optional settings on the account entry, a Story or a Reel for instance, and one needs a value fetched from it before the post will be accepted at all. The skill lists exactly what each platform takes, and the page for the platform you are posting to states it too.
Done when you know whether the platform you are posting to needs anything of its own.
- 7
Create the post in one call, and default to a draft. One
publishq_create_post(orpq posts create) takes as many accounts as you want, each with its ownpostOverrides(its own text, or its own replacement media) and its ownplatformSpecificSettings.accountIdnames an account rather than a platform, so several accounts on the same platform go out in the same call; do not loop one call per account. Omitting both scheduledAt and publishNow saves a draft, and passing scheduledAt queues the post for that time. Reach for publishNow only when the user asked to publish now in those words. A draft or a schedule keeps the human in the loop, since both stay editable until they fire.Done when the response shows the state the user asked for.
- 8
Report back. Name the accounts you reached, the state the post ended up in (draft, scheduled for a stated time, or published), and its post id, so the user can find it in the dashboard.

Every command, and the MCP tool that matches it
One contract behind every surface, so an agent that learns one column already knows the other. Same names, same arguments, same result.
| CLI | MCP tool | What it does |
|---|---|---|
pq accounts list | publishq_list_accounts | The connected accounts and their IDs.Start here |
pq posts create | publishq_create_post | Draft, schedule or publish to one or more accounts in a single call. |
pq posts list | publishq_list_posts | Everything drafted, queued or already out. |
pq posts get <id> | publishq_get_post | One post, and how it went per account. |
pq posts update <id> | publishq_update_post | Change the content or the time before it fires. |
pq posts delete <id> | publishq_delete_post | Cancel a draft or a scheduled post.Destructive |
pq posts remove-account <id> <accountId> | publishq_remove_post_account | Drop one account and leave the rest of the post standing. |
pq media upload --file <path> | publishq_upload_media | Upload once, then attach by id to every account in the post. |
pq media list | publishq_list_media | Media already uploaded or generated. |
pq accounts tiktok-creator-info <id> | publishq_get_tiktok_creator_info | The privacy options a TikTok post has to choose from.TikTok requires this first |
pq workspaces list | publishq_list_workspaces | Workspaces, when one login holds several sets of accounts. |
Add --pretty to any command for indented JSON. Every argument, and the response shape for each call, is in the CLI reference and the MCP reference.

Keeping a self-hosted agent on a short leash
Approval prompts are the control that applies either way: you read the post it's about to make, in the same chat window you asked from, and answer yes or no. On the MCP route there is a second one, a per-server tool filter that decides which PublishQ tools the agent can even see, so it can get account listing and post creation while deletion stays out of reach entirely.
- A tool you leave out of the filter doesn't exist as far as the agent knows.
- Ask for a draft and it goes to your dashboard instead of your audience.
- Deleting the key ends it instantly and leaves every account connected.
